A BILL

TO AMEND THE CODE OF LAWS OF SOUTH CAROLINA, 1976, BY ADDING SECTION 2-7-55 SO AS TO REQUIRE THE CODE COMMISSIONER TO ANNOTATE IN THE SOUTH CAROLINA CODE OF LAWS ALL UNPUBLISHED FEDERAL OPINIONS DECIDED IN THE DISTRICT HAVING AN EFFECT ON THE INTERPRETATION OR INVALIDATIONS OF SOUTH CAROLINA STATUTES WHICH HAVE BEEN SENT TO HIM BY THE CHIEF FEDERAL DISTRICT JUDGE.

Be it enacted by the General Assembly of the State of South Carolina:

SECTION 1. The 1976 Code is amended by adding:

"Section 2-7-55. The Code Commissioner shall annotate in the South Carolina Code of Laws all unpublished opinions sent to him by the Chief Federal District Judge of the South Carolina District which, in the Code Commissioner's opinion, affect or invalidate a South Carolina statute, act, or resolution."

SECTION 2. This act takes effect upon approval by the Governor.
